From 541572e4150b91199425425fa5677c4e9940cb5e Mon Sep 17 00:00:00 2001 From: Spythere Date: Mon, 15 Apr 2024 18:32:19 +0200 Subject: [PATCH] refactor: stock & vehicle typings --- src/components/app/MainContainer.vue | 4 +- src/components/sections/InputsSection.vue | 12 ++-- src/components/sections/TrainImageSection.vue | 44 +++++++++---- src/components/tabs/StockGeneratorTab.vue | 11 +++- src/components/tabs/StockListTab.vue | 65 ++++++++++--------- src/components/tabs/WikiListTab.vue | 37 +++++++---- src/components/utils/StockThumbnails.vue | 25 ++++--- src/mixins/stockMixin.ts | 29 ++++----- src/mixins/stockPreviewMixin.ts | 21 +++--- src/store.ts | 15 +++-- src/styles/global.scss | 2 +- src/types.ts | 16 ++--- src/utils/vehicleUtils.ts | 27 ++++---- 13 files changed, 175 insertions(+), 133 deletions(-) diff --git a/src/components/app/MainContainer.vue b/src/components/app/MainContainer.vue index a5ab0d5..6b439cf 100644 --- a/src/components/app/MainContainer.vue +++ b/src/components/app/MainContainer.vue @@ -42,7 +42,9 @@ main { @media screen and (max-width: $breakpointMd) { main { - display: block; + display: flex; + flex-direction: column; + gap: 1em; } } diff --git a/src/components/sections/InputsSection.vue b/src/components/sections/InputsSection.vue index a7728d7..5d7d6b8 100644 --- a/src/components/sections/InputsSection.vue +++ b/src/components/sections/InputsSection.vue @@ -28,7 +28,8 @@ {{ $t('inputs.input-vehicle') }} @@ -59,7 +60,8 @@ @@ -84,6 +86,7 @@ +